By Anietie Akpan
Akwa Ibom State Governor, Pastor Umo Eno,PhD, has received with regrets the news of the demise of Akwa Ibom born former national football team legends, Charles Bassey, and Skipper Christian Chukwu
Both men passed on Saturday, April 12, 2025 in their respective cities, Eket in Akwa Ibom state and Enugu in Enugu state.
In a message through his Chief Press Secretary, Ekerete Udoh, Governor Eno, described the passing of Charles Bassey, MON as a monumental loss to the State and Nation and also sent his deepest condolences to Bassey’s former National soccer teammate and former Coach of the Super Eagles, Christian Chukwu, who also died yesterday in Enugu.
Governor Eno who eulogized the pioneering role of Coach Bassey and Coach Chukwu in the development of football in the country, added that their sad passing on the same day, has created a huge vacuum in the Nigerian football space.
“Coach Bassey was phenomenal in handling several top football clubs in the country, and played a pivotal role in talents discovery in our State, when he coached Mobil Pegasus FC and subsequently, Akwa United FC.
“At a time when we are establishing a modern sports academy in the State, Coach Bassey’s wealth of experience would have been invaluable to our young ones.
“I urge Coach Bassey’s family to be consoled by the indelible impact he created, and the affectionate love that bonded them while he lived.
“I also sympathize with the family of Late Christian “Chairman“ Chukwu,MFR, our former national team coach and former national team captain, whose leadership role in football development both on the pitch and the sideline brought so much fame to our country”, the statement added.
